Genetic Factors in Autism: What the Science Reveals

Autism Spectrum Disorder (ASD) affects 1 in 36 children in the U.S., according to the CDC’s 2025 data. While environmental triggers like prenatal exposures play a role, genetic factors in autism dominate the conversation among researchers. Twin studies show heritability rates up to 90%, meaning genes load the gun—but they don’t pull the trigger alone. The Heritability of Autism: A Family Affair

Genetics isn’t just one gene—it’s a symphony. Identical twins share 100% of their DNA and have an 80-90% concordance rate for autism, per a 2024 meta-analysis in Nature Genetics. Fraternal twins, with 50% shared DNA, show only 10-20% concordance. This stark difference underscores genetic factors in autism as the strongest predictor.

  • Polygenic risk: Most cases involve hundreds of common gene variants, each contributing small effects. Tools like polygenic risk scores (PRS) now predict ASD likelihood with 10-15% accuracy.

  • Family patterns: Siblings of autistic children have a 20% recurrence risk, rising if the first child is male.

These insights guide early screening in families with ASD history.

Key Genes Linked to Autism

Over 1,000 genes are implicated in ASD, identified through large-scale projects like the Simons Foundation Autism Research Initiative (SFARI). Here’s a spotlight on the heavy hitters:

Gene Role Impact on Autism
SHANK3 Synapse formation Mutations cause 1-2% of cases; disrupts social communication.
CHD8 Chromatin remodeling Largest single-gene effect; linked to macrocephaly and GI issues.
NRXN1/NTNG1 Neural connections Alters brain wiring, affecting sensory processing.
MECP2 (Rett syndrome overlap) Gene regulation X-linked; more severe in girls.

Rare de novo mutations—new changes not inherited from parents—account for 10-20% of cases, often in sperm or egg cells. A 2025 study in Cell highlighted how these disrupt excitatory-inhibitory balance in the brain, leading to ASD traits like repetitive behaviors.

Copy Number Variations (CNVs): Big Deletions, Big Effects

CNVs are DNA chunks duplicated or deleted, spanning thousands of genes. They’re found in 10-15% of ASD cases:

  • 16p11.2 deletion/duplication: Increases ASD risk 20-fold; tied to intellectual disability.

  • 22q11.2 (DiGeorge syndrome): 20% of carriers develop autism.

Advanced testing like chromosomal microarray detects these, enabling targeted therapies. For instance, CNV-related ASD often responds well to behavioral interventions like ABA therapy.

Gene-Environment Interactions: Not Genes Alone

Genetic factors in autism set the stage, but environment directs the play. Epigenetics—chemical tags on DNA—explains how stress, pollution, or maternal infections “turn on” ASD genes. A 2024 EPIC study found that kids with high genetic risk plus advanced parental age face 2-3x higher odds.

Implications for Diagnosis and Treatment

Genetic testing via whole-exome sequencing (WES) is now recommended for all ASD diagnoses, per American College of Medical Genetics guidelines. It identifies causes in 30-40% of cases, opening doors to precision medicine:

  • Gene therapies: CRISPR trials for SHANK3 mutations began in 2025.

  • Pharmacogenomics: Tailoring meds like risperidone based on CYP2D6 gene variants reduces side effects.

  • Early intervention: Knowing genetic profiles predicts therapy response—e.g., CHD8 carriers benefit from speech therapy.

The Road Ahead for Autism Genetics

Research explodes with AI-driven genome analysis. The 2025 Autism Sequencing Consortium mapped 5,000+ ASD genomes, revealing sex differences: females need stronger genetic hits to “show” autism due to protective factors.
